Wasn't quite sure how to phrase that. But I raise Rex, and love the fur. I refuse to purposefully kill my rabbits for human use, though I've no problem with other people who do it, but I like to make use of animals once they die. So basically what I want to know is if it would be a problem to tan the hides of rabbits that die from other causes? As long as they are in good condition, that is.

OnTheBrightside":11gv3ioz said:
MamaSheepdog, I thought the same thing but didn't know if maybe the rabbit was dead a few hours before you found it, overnight maybe, the hide wouldn't be the same as it is right after death.

At worst the hair will slip due to bacteria/decay. At best you'll wind up with a tanned hide. The cause of death should not play a part. Just wear gloves when skinning.
